Many of our veteran users may remember "CaliMaestro" from a few years ago on the forums. He's been busy with life and we haven't heard from him much at all. Well, he has recently come to us with some pretty interesting details concerning a new "indie" fighting game that he and his wife have been working on. CaliMaestro, with years of experience in the video game industry and his wife with equal experience in the film industry... would like to reveal and announce a brand new fighting game that will be play-tested by members of Epic Gamer Productions (or EGP).

Addition details from CaliMaestro:


Hi TYM!

Well, the time is now, and I can now spill the beans! I've left my safe and secure job in California as a video game Producer to startup a new development studio called Hollow Rock Entertainment along with my wife. The studio is comprised of my wife as CEO (film and business graduate from USC), myself as Creative Director & Lead Developer, and one artist. We will be adding people soon though.

We have moved back to my home state of Alabama. We already own a house here, and now that we no longer have the crazy expensive California cost of living... we can put more into the game.
The game is called 'Fright Fights', the name is an omage to the classic horror movie 'Fright Night'. My wife has secured the rights to several famous horror genre figures from both film and literature - and these are the characters that players will be using when playing the game.

'Fright Fights' is a 2D fighter currently featuring the folowing cast:

-The Phantom of the Opera
-Nosferatu
-Van Helsing
-Dracula
-Dr. Frankenstein
-Frankenstein's Monster
-Dr. Jeckyll
-Mr. Hyde

There are many more characters that we are in the process of closing out the rights to having - but until we finish the legal process, we cannot yet announce who the rest of the cast is.

The coolest part of the project though is that we have partnered directly with Chaney Entertainment. Lon Chaney Sr. played the original and most classic version of the Phantom of the Opera, and his son, Lon Chaney Jr., was famous for his depiction of the Wolf Man in the classic 1930s Universal version of The Wolf Man.

Chaney Entertainment is comprised of the surviving Chaney family members, and they are looking to bring their family characters and history to a new and younger audience via this game. You can imagine how excited we are to be developing this game alongside such a historic film family.

You can expect members of our EGP team to be helping playtest and balance the game. I'll also be looking to enlist key members from the MK and Injustice scene if they are interested in helping.
There is a Kickstarter campaign going live next week to support the project. Any help you could give us leading up to then would be greatly appreciated. Also, if you could run an article the day that the Kickstarter goes live... you have no idea how much we would appreciate it.
You and all of TYM have a spot waiting in the game credits =)

The game will be available on PC, Mac, iOS, Android, Windows Phone 8, Linux, and we are looking into Playstation 4 and Vita.
